Abstract: A survey monument has a simple spring clip extraction restricting means formed as a wire form spring member to provide a straight leg inserted in a diametral opening in the rod and a curved co-planar leg which effects a snap fit with the outer periphery of the rod. An axially extending leg is offset radially outwardly and yields to displacement while imparting rotational torque to the rod when the rod is driven into the ground, but opens and restricts extraction when the rod is moved in an opposite direction.
Abstract: A method and device for filleting fish using an adjustable cutting blade, having a cutting edge mounted between first and second parallel legs which are rigidly connected by a base portion, opposed to the cutting blade. The length and curvature of the blade may be adjusted to conform to the thickness and roundness of the fish to be filleted.
Abstract: An apparatus and method is provided for the placement of a heat-shrinkable film over the open portion of a container such as a glass, paper or plastic cup. The apparatus is particularly suitable for rapid placement of a heat-shrinkable film on food and beverage containers such as are commonly used in the fast-food service business. The apparatus comprises a film transport subsystem for withdrawing heat shrinkable film from a supply roll, cutting the film to size and positioning it for shrinkage onto a container and a heating subsystem which shrinks the film onto the top of a container. Operation of the apparatus is initiated by manual placement of the top of a container to be covered, against the film, pushing the container and film upwardly into the apparatus. The upward movement of the container engages the film and container top with a bonnet which initiates blowing of hot air of heat shrinkable temperatures to heat the exposed edges of the film and shrink the film onto the container.
